Nuclear Engineers Salary in Georgia

Source: Bureau of Labor Statistics, May 2024

Median in Georgia
$129,820
National Median
$127,520
Employment
140
Entry Level (10th)
$73,490
Top Earners (90th)
$200,730

How Georgia Compares

Georgia pays $2,300 more than the national median for nuclear engineerss.

There are 0.03 nuclear engineers jobs per 1,000 workers in Georgia (location quotient: 0.31).
